Web12 Jan 2024 · A preliminary evaluation of the stability of the ship can be made by looking at the hydrostatics As a vessel is loaded, the draft and trim of the vessel keep changing with the weight and location of the loads. Loads can be cargo, passengers, fuel, ballast, etc. and these keep varying during the voyage of the vessel.

Webreferred to as having a positive GM or a positive initial stability. UNSTABLE EQUILIBRIUM If the centre of gravity (G) of a vessel is above the metacentre (M) the vessel is said to have a negative GM or a negative initial stability.
